Output 93f643d607975faef5877b95fc7ea215a456c101da16ccdb81c35f4face6d1ee:0

value
334231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 944e05fc01bde76acb8952276c94bd3d09826763 OP_EQUAL
address
3FDBQ6Q8X9fFi4kzCh5HX3qqcTGRGA2WuH
transaction
93f643d607975faef5877b95fc7ea215a456c101da16ccdb81c35f4face6d1ee
confirmations
227056
spent
true